| CERE present at the Society for Benefit-Cost Analysis Fourth Annual Conference and Meeting |
|
|
|
This annual conference is held in Washington, D.C and focuses on the use of Benefit-Cost Analysis (BCA) in a variety of social programs, broadening and improving measurement of benefits and/or costs. This year's conference opened on October 21st, attracting more than 100 economists from the world to present. Göran Bostedt and Scott Cole from CERE participated presented and received a positive feedback. In panel 13, Göran Bostedt presented his paper associated with the PlusMinus Programme which is "Global Conflicts and Benefit-Cost Analysis-The Case of Sweden's National Environmental Objectives". In the panel 16, Scott Cole presented the third paper of his thesis "Asking the Wrong Questions: Is Resource-Based Compensation for Environmental Damage Restricting Social Welfare Gains?"
